Live Life with Delight Not Fear

You only get a one way trip in this life so make it count!

Photo by Matthew Hamilton on Unsplash

Life is a banquet, and most poor bastards are starving to death. — Patrick Dennis, Auntie Mame

I love this quote because it’s so true. There’s so much available to us in life, but most of the time we’re focusing on what we don’t have instead.

So how can you cultivate more delight in your life?

Here’s some ideas to get you started.

  1. Try something new. One of the reasons people get bogged down in life is because they avoid new experiences and get stuck in a rut. Don’t let that be you.
  2. Travel more. You can start traveling locally and then get adventurous and take longer trips. Traveling takes you out of your normal routine and gives you a new perspective.
  3. Decide to follow the fun in your life. Do things you love and treat yourself with kindness while you’re doing it.
  4. Get out of your comfort zone. Do something wild and crazy. Take a chance on yourself.
  5. Stop tolerating things that don’t work for you and make you miserable.
  6. Stop listening to that critical voice in your head. You are OK just as you are.
  7. Do something that scares the heck out of you every day.
  8. Go for your big dreams and swing for the fences. You’ll never know how far you’ll go unless you try.
  9. Stop listening to negative people who don’t get you.
  10. Believe in yourself! You are capable of so much more than you think.

Key Message: You can decide to live your life with delight instead of fear whenever you choose. The point of power is with you right now. Use it.
